  1. The final Gekan slumped bonelessly to the floor, the lizard-like Grimm expiring and breaking down into motes of dark light that fluttered away on a non-existent breeze. The chirping of insects and birds was all that remained as the clearing descended into peaceful silence, broken only by the quiet rasp of Crocea Mors being sheathed once more.
  2.  
  3. "This is it?" I drew out the map I'd been given over a year ago and carefully opened it up. A quick check confirmed what I believed to be true. I was on the far east edge of the Emerald Forest, literally on the border of Forever Fall and as far as I could go without packing for a day or more's journey. I had, quite literally, reached the furthest expanse of the Emerald Forest.
  4.  
  5. And I'd found no challenge.
  6.  
  7. "According to Coco, there isn't an area with Grimm of a higher level," I whispered, reading through the notes I'd bought from the Guild Leader less than a week ago. "These are the strongest Grimm I'll find." A sigh escaped me.
